[–] Powderhorn@beehaw.org 5 points 1 week ago* (last edited 6 days ago) (2 children)

From our other interactions, I'm going to suggest:

Cracking the Cryptic ... it can be oddly satisfying to watch them solve a puzzle.

Anton Petrov for space news.

If you're not familiar with Sabine Hossenfelder, I'd be very surprised, but she's great for wider physics.

Robert Reich is doing some great things these days. The Saturday Coffee Klatsch is a must-watch for me, even if it gets a little predictable.

Beau of the Fifth Column, whom I'm aware from an earlier post is not highly regarded, burned out, and his wife has continued the channel. Rarely more then 5 minutes, and there's never footage, just the news and quality analysis.

I'm getting somewhat tired of Bryan Tyler Cohen's clickbait bullshit, but his panelists can be helpful in unpacking news.

[–] Thevenin@beehaw.org 3 points 1 week ago (1 children)

Based on Drew Builds Stuff:

  • Stuff Made Here, applying high technology and robotics to low-stakes challenges.
  • The Thought Emporium (Also on Nebula). One day, they're artificially aging whiskey with ultrasound, the next, the host is editing his own genes to remove lactose intolerance.

Based on the intersection of building and the great outdoors:

  • Quiet Nerd, who's been building a lot of camping equipment lately.

Some shots in the dark, based on exploration and documenting the unseen:

Based on Baumgartner Restoration:

  • Hand Tool Rescue, a channel where they lovingly restore antique tools and machines.

[–] xylem@beehaw.org 3 points 1 week ago (1 children)
  • Clickspring - gently narrated master craftsmanship, in this case watchmaking. His Antikythera Mechanism series is particularly awesome
  • Adventurous Way - previously RVing content, now building a house in Vermont
